Overview
Embedded connectors are specialized mechanical components designed for pre-installation into concrete or other structural materials. They serve as anchor points for attaching other structural elements, ensuring stability and durability. Commonly used in construction and industrial settings, these connectors eliminate the need for post-installation drilling, saving time and labor costs. Their design varies based on application, with options for different load capacities and environmental conditions. Embedded connectors are favored for their ability to distribute loads evenly, reducing stress concentrations that could compromise structural integrity.
Structure and Working Principle
Embedded connectors typically consist of a metal body with threaded ends or flanges for attachment. The working principle involves embedding the connector into wet concrete or mortar, allowing it to cure and form a permanent bond. Once set, the connector provides a robust anchor point for bolts, rods, or other fixtures. The design often includes features like ribs or flanges to enhance grip within the material. Some variants are coated for corrosion resistance, making them suitable for outdoor or high-moisture environments. Proper installation ensures optimal load distribution and long-term performance.
Key Features
Embedded connectors are known for their high load-bearing capacity, often rated for several tons depending on size and material. Their pre-installed design reduces on-site labor and minimizes errors during construction. Corrosion-resistant coatings, such as galvanization or stainless steel, extend their lifespan in harsh conditions. Another key feature is their versatility. They can be customized for specific applications, including seismic-resistant designs or high-temperature environments. The ease of integration with other structural components makes them a preferred choice for modern construction projects.
Application Areas
Embedded connectors are widely used in construction for securing steel beams, columns, and facade systems. They are also essential in infrastructure projects like bridges and tunnels, where durable connections are critical. Industrial applications include machinery bases, heavy equipment installations, and modular building systems. In addition to traditional construction, these connectors are gaining popularity in prefabricated and modular construction. Their ability to provide reliable connections without post-installation work aligns with the efficiency goals of modern building techniques.
Maintenance and Precautions
Embedded connectors require minimal maintenance once installed correctly. However, periodic inspections are recommended to check for signs of corrosion or loosening, especially in high-stress or corrosive environments. Proper alignment during installation is crucial to avoid misalignment, which can lead to structural weaknesses. Precautions include using compatible materials to prevent galvanic corrosion and ensuring the surrounding concrete or mortar is of adequate strength. For high-load applications, consulting engineering specifications is advised to select the appropriate connector type and installation method.
